
Earlier this year, at the Cannes Film Festival, we interviewed Sepideh Farsi on her heart-wrenching documentary Put Your Soul on Your Hand and Walk, which charts the Iranian filmmaker’s correspondence with Palestinian photojournalist and poet Fatma Hassona as she documented and endured Israel’s ongoing genocide of the Palestinian people in Gaza. Hassona and her family were later targeted and killed at their Gaza home by the IDF only a day after Farsi informed her the film would be premiering at the festival.
As Put Your Soul on Your Hand and Walk, which we described as one of the most urgent films of the year, approaches its UK premiere at the Edinburgh Film Festival on 19th August and UK and Irish release in cinemas on 22nd August, Farsi provides us a personal list of recommended reading on Palestine.
